If the front of your legs hurts after running, you have probably heard the term shin splints thrown around. But shin splints is actually a catch-all term that can mean a few different things, and not all of them are treated the same way.

Some causes are pretty manageable with rest and activity modification. Others, like a tibial stress fracture, need attention sooner rather than later.

If you have been dealing with hip flexor pain during or after your runs, you are not alone. It is one of the most common issues runners run into, and it is often more connected to what the rest of the body is doing than people realize.

Weakness in the core or hamstrings can put extra demand on the hip flexors over time. And when the load exceeds what those tissues can handle, that is when pain shows up.
